** Shares in Munters MTRS.ST drop 8.1% after the Swedish
air treatment solutions provider posted its Q3 print below
market expectations, amid continued weak battery outlook
** "In AirTech organic order intake was negative, mainly
driven by the weaker battery market," the company says in a
statement
** It adds that the market has seen delays in investments
across all regions, resulting in significantly decreased demand
over the past quarter and aggressive price pressure
** "We anticipate these challenging conditions to remain in
2025," the company says
** Peer Swedish Nederman NMAN.ST is down 5.6% after the
company's third quarter adjusted EBITA fall year-on-year
** Shares in Munters are the second worst performers on
pan-European STOXX 600 index .STOXX
